Get started49 Brabazon Drive is a four-bedroom detached house in Christchurch (BH23 4TL). It has a recorded floor area of 122 m² (around 1313 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(January 2013);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 4.1%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£445/sq ft) was about 74%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 122 m² the property is well over the postcode median (86 m² across 22 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Last sale on file: £585,000 in November 2023.
